Novel case will go to court: Police chief

N

ational Police chief Gen. Badrodin Haiti said the police have no plans to drop the Novel Baswedan case and he would continue to be investigated so as to be brought to court.

'€œRegarding the Novel Baswedan case, we hope it will be settled in court. He will be proven guilty or not depending on evidence presented by the police to the court so that the police will not be accused of criminalizing him,'€ he said at the Attorney General'€™s Office here on Monday.

Badrodin said the police have their own interest in bringing this case and two others, implicating former leaders of the Corruption Eradication Commission (KPK) Abraham Samad and Bambang Widjojanto, to court so that the public could understand.

'€œWe have reached a joint agreement (with the KPK) to settle the three cases in court,'€ he said as quoted by kompas.com.

Novel has been held as a suspect in a shooting case that took place when he was chief of detectives with the Bengkulu Provincial Police in 2004. (rms)(+++)
